Definitions:

UCC's Writing Requirements

refers to the stipulations under the Uniform Commercial Code that dictate when a contract must be in writing to be enforceable.

Written Agreement

A legally binding contract that is documented in a written format and signed by all parties involved.

Partial-Performance Exception

A legal principle allowing for the enforcement of an otherwise unenforceable contract due to one party's significant reliance on the agreement and performance.

Statute Of Frauds

A legal doctrine requiring certain types of contracts to be in written form and signed to be enforceable, aimed at preventing fraudulent claims.
